Inspirational Quotes of Body Acceptance

  1. “Your body is not a temple, it’s the house you live in. Treat it with love and respect.”
    This quote reminds us that our bodies are not just objects but the vessels of our experiences.
  2. “You are imperfect, permanently and inevitably flawed. And you are beautiful.” – Amy Bloom
    Accepting imperfections is a key part of loving ourselves fully.
  3. “The most beautiful thing you can wear is confidence.” – Blake Lively
    Confidence can elevate our natural beauty more than any trend or outfit.
  4. “Beauty begins the moment you decide to be yourself.” – Coco Chanel
    Authenticity is the foundation of true beauty.
  5. “Love yourself first, and everything else falls into line.” – Lucille Ball
    Self-love is crucial; it sets the tone for how you relate to the world.
  6. “Your body is a canvas, and you are the artist. Paint your masterpiece.”
    This quote emphasizes the uniqueness of each individual and the beauty that lies in self-expression.
  7. “I am not my body. My body is a part of me, but it does not define who I am.” – Unknown
    A powerful reminder that our worth goes far beyond physical appearance.
  8. “You don’t have to be perfect to be beautiful.” – Unknown
    Perfection is an illusion; embracing our flaws is what makes us truly beautiful.
  9. “The way you treat yourself sets the standard for others.” – Sonya Friedman
    Self-respect and acceptance are essential for fostering healthy relationships with others.
  10. “Happiness is not about what you look like; it’s about how you feel about yourself.” – Unknown
    True happiness comes from within and is rooted in self-love rather than external validation.

The Importance of Body Acceptance

Body acceptance goes beyond just loving how we look; it’s about appreciating our bodies for what they can do. Every scar, every curve, and every imperfection tells a story. Here are a few reasons why embracing body acceptance and body positivity is essential:

  • Mental Well-being: Accepting your body can lead to improved self-esteem and reduced anxiety.
  • Healthy Choices: When you love your body, you’re more likely to treat it well with nutritious food and physical activity.
  • Positive Relationships: Embracing yourself can foster healthier relationships with others, free from comparison and judgment.
